Job Description: Senior Data & AI Engineer
Role:
The Senior Data & AI Engineer owns the full technical stack, including connectors, ingestion framework, OneLake Medallion staging, GraphDB triple store, Vector Index, Agentic RAG orchestrator, LLM gateway, guardrails, and the consumption UI with conversational chat, SPARQL trace explainability, and graph explorer.
Responsibilities:
- Develop and maintain graph databases (GraphDB, Neo4j, Stardog) in production or advanced PoC setups.
- Load, validate, and query ontologies within triple store environments.
- Collaborate with Data Consultants on ontology modeling using tools like Protégé or Metaphactory.
- Build and optimize RAG pipelines with agentic orchestration.
- Work with vector databases for embedding and retrieval tasks.
- Integrate LLM APIs (e.g., Anthropic Claude, OpenAI GPT, Azure OpenAI) with prompt engineering, guardrails, and citation mechanisms.
- Develop NL-to-SPARQL or NL-to-SQL generation solutions, employing few-shot prompting and schema grounding.
- Implement AI safety measures including prompt injection defenses, output sandboxing, and confidence scoring.
- Operate within an 8-week delivery cycle with weekly milestones.
- Collaborate closely with data modeling and ontologist teams.
- Leverage experience in financial services or insurance data environments where possible.
Required Skills:
- 3+ years of hands-on experience with graph databases and semantic web standards.
- Proficiency in ontology authoring tools.
- Proven experience with RAG pipelines and agentic orchestration.
- Expertise in vector databases and LLM API integration.
- Knowledge of NL-to-SPARQL/NL-to-SQL conversion techniques.
- Strong understanding of AI safety protocols.
- Project management skills suitable for rapid development cycles.
- Excellent collaboration and communication skills.

Which visa types are most common for AI data engineer roles in Pennsylvania?
The H-1B is the most common visa category for AI data engineers in Pennsylvania. These roles typically qualify as specialty occupations because they require at least a bachelor's degree in computer science, data engineering, or a closely related field. Candidates already on F-1 OPT or STEM OPT can work while their employer files an H-1B petition. The O-1A is an option for candidates with demonstrable recognition in AI or data engineering, though it requires substantial documentation.

Which cities in Pennsylvania have the most AI data engineer sponsorship jobs?
Pittsburgh and Philadelphia account for the majority of AI data engineer sponsorship activity in Pennsylvania. Pittsburgh's concentration of university research labs, robotics companies, and AI-focused startups makes it a particularly active market, with Carnegie Mellon University itself hiring for engineering and research-adjacent roles. Philadelphia draws sponsoring employers in healthcare IT, financial services, and enterprise software. Smaller hubs like Malvern and Wayne in the Philadelphia suburbs also have a notable presence of tech company offices that file H-1B petitions.
Are there any Pennsylvania-specific considerations for AI data engineers seeking visa sponsorship?
Pennsylvania's AI data engineering market benefits from strong university pipelines, particularly from Carnegie Mellon, Penn, and Drexel, which means many employers in the state already have established processes for sponsoring international candidates transitioning from student visas. Prevailing wage requirements for H-1B filings are set by the Department of Labor and vary by metropolitan area, so the wage level attached to a Pittsburgh-based role will differ from a Philadelphia-based one even for the same job title.
What is the prevailing wage for sponsored ai data engineer jobs in Pennsylvania?
U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
